This project investigates the role of a protein called connexin 30 in memory processes during sleep. It aims to understand how this protein influences neuronal activity and memory consolidation through a combination of experimental techniques.
It is believed that sleep plays an important role in memory consolidation.
In rodents, hippocampal neurons (place cells) selectively discharge when the animal is in a specific location in space.
During subsequent sleep, they are reactivated in the same order at 200Hz network oscillations known as ripples.
This timescale is optimal for synaptic plasticity underlying memory.
